How can you enter or advance in this exciting, high-growth field? This four-course credit sequence provides an overview of the fundamental areas of construction management. Develop and expand your managerial skills in courses created and approved by the UW College of Architecture and Urban Planning. Representatives of top businesses such as Turner Construction, GLY Construction, Absher Construction and HNTB Corp. serve on the program's advisory board.
Instructors are leading professionals currently active in construction management, or UW faculty specializing in the field. Individuals who have undergraduate degrees in non-construction disciplines can use this certificate program to meet some prerequisites for admission to the UW master's program in construction management.
Formats and Credits
- Participants receive 14 credits and a certificate upon completion of the program. A permanent transcript of coursework is kept.
- Participants have access to resources of University of Washington libraries while enrolled in this program.
